The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in Tyne and Wear requiring Sprint Planning sk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 6 October 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
6 Oct 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 36 27 26
Rank change year-on-year -9 -1 +31
Contract jobs citing Sprint Planning 4 5 1
As % of all contract jobs in Tyne and Wear 1.65% 2.53% 0.61%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 1.90% 2.78% 0.71%
Number of daily rates quoted 4 5 0
10th Percentile £473 £355 -
25th Percentile £506 £400 -
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£538 £410 -
Median % change year-on-year +31.10% - -
75th Percentile £575 £480 -
90th Percentile - £528 -
North East median daily rate £538 £410 -
% change year-on-year +31.10% - -
